Changeset 410 for trunk/userlist.php


Ignore:
Timestamp:
Mar 31, 2010, 9:11:05 PM (15 years ago)
Author:
george
Message:
  • Přidáno: Záložka Statistika v exportu zobrazující stav dokončení exportu.
  • Upraveno: Zobrazení celkového stavu dokončení překladu přepracováno na standardní tabulku se zobrazením procent dokončení.
  • Upraveno: Zobrazení úrovně a zkušeností ve zobrazení překladatelů se nyní zobrazuje pomocí HTML procent.
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/userlist.php

    r378 r410  
    3737  array('Name' => 'TranslatedCount', 'Title' => 'Přeložených'),
    3838  array('Name' => 'XP', 'Title' => 'Úroveň'),
    39   array('Name' => 'GM', 'Title' => 'Oprávnění'),
     39  array('Name' => 'XP', 'Title' => 'Zkušenost'),
     40  //array('Name' => 'GM', 'Title' => 'Oprávnění'),
    4041  array('Name' => 'LastLogin', 'Title' => 'Poslední připojení'),
    4142);
     
    4445
    4546
    46 $Query = 'SELECT `ID`, `User`.`Name`, `LastLogin`, `GM`, `TranslatedCount` FROM `User` '.$_SESSION['Where'].$Order['SQL'].$PageList['SQLLimit'];
     47$Query = 'SELECT `ID`, `User`.`Name`, `LastLogin`, `GM`, `XP`, `TranslatedCount` FROM `User` '.$_SESSION['Where'].$Order['SQL'].$PageList['SQLLimit'];
    4748
    4849$ID = $Database->SQLCommand($Query);
     
    5354    else $Name = $Line['Name'];
    5455       
     56    $XP = GetLevelMinMax($Line['XP']);
    5557    echo('<tr><td>'.$Name.'</td>
    56       <td style="text-align: center;"><a href="TranslationList.php?user='.$Line['ID'].'&amp;action=userall" title="Zobrazit Všechny jeho přeložené texty">'.$Line['TranslatedCount'].'</a></td>
    57       <td><img src="tmp/user/'.$Line['Name'].'/level.png" alt="Úroveň uživatele" /></td>
    58       <td>'.$Moderators[$Line['GM']].'</td>
    59       <td>'.HumanDate($Line['LastLogin']).'</td></tr>');
     58      <td style="text-align: center;"><a href="TranslationList.php?user='.$Line['ID'].'&amp;action=userall" title="Zobrazit Všechny jeho přeložené texty">'.$Line['TranslatedCount'].'</a></td>'.
     59      '<td>'.$XP['Level'].'</td>'.
     60      '<td>'.ProgressBar(150, round($XP['XP'] / $XP['MaxXP'] * 100, 2), $XP['XP'].' / '.$XP['MaxXP']).'</td>'.
     61      //<td>'.$Moderators[$Line['GM']].'</td>
     62      '<td>'.HumanDate($Line['LastLogin']).'</td></tr>');
    6063}
    6164echo('</table>');
Note: See TracChangeset for help on using the changeset viewer.